Taylor Swift has promised fans that her performance at the upcoming MTV Video Music Awards will be "different" to anything that she has done before.
The 19-year-old has been confirmed to perform her latest single 'You Belong With Me' at the September 13 ceremony in New York.
Speaking to MTV News, she said: "[The song] is not going to be as different musically as it's going to be different in that I've never done anything on an awards show like I'm going to do on this one.
"It's in New York, so anything can happen... I would love to perform somewhere outside of the venue."
She added: "I think it could be really cool if it was unlike anything I've ever done at an awards show, which would mean doing it at a different location."
The 2009 MTV Video Music Awards, hosted by Russell Brand, will broadcast this Sunday from 9pm.

The hits just keep on coming for the 2009 MTV Video Music Awards, and the latest performance announcement is a huge one: Janet Jackson will be performing a tribute to her late brother Michael, who passed away back in June. In fact, Janet's tribute will open Sunday night's show, which is fitting considering Michael was responsible for one of the greatest opening segments in Video Music Awards history, when in 1995 he performed a medley of some of his biggest hits (which included a guest guitar solo by Velvet Revolver axeman Slash) before scoring three Moonmen for his video for "Scream" (his one and only collaboration with sister Janet).
It's still unclear what songs will be included in Janet's tribute to her brother, but considering it's the Video Music Awards and Michael was such a huge icon in the music video universe, it's easy to assume it will incorporate some of his bigger video moments (it would be shocking if it didn't include at least a portion of the "Thriller" dance). Janet, a nine-time Moonman winner herself (including a Video Vanguard prize and two wins for Best Female Video), is no stranger to the VMA stage herself, having performed three times previously and was last on the show in 2000 at Radio City Music Hall (where she performed "Doesn't Really Matter"). Though Michael Jackson is gone, the King of Pop will be front and center during the 2009 MTV Video Music Awards on Sunday. Not only will his sister Janet make a musical tribute to her brother with a special appearance to help open the show, but we can now reveal that viewers will get their first look at the MJ documentary "This Is It" during the live broadcast, when the trailer premieres on MTV.
Drawn from more than 100 hours of behind-the-scenes footage and produced with the full support of Jackson's family, "This Is It" chronicles the last three months of the superstar's life as he sought to stage a series of 50 sold-out comeback concerts at London's O2 arena. The documentary shows MJ developing the show and rehearsing a number of songs during his final days. "This Is It" is directed by Kenny Ortega, Jackson's creative partner and the director of the planned O2 stage show. Sony Pictures plans to release the film in theaters for a limited two-week engagement, starting on October 28.
MTV will also exclusively premiere an extended trailer for another hotly anticipated fall movie, "New Moon," the second installment of the "Twilight" vampire franchise. Stars Robert Pattinson, Kristen Stewart and Taylor Lautner will be on hand to debut the footage. "New Moon" co-star Ashley Greene will also be at the show, serving as MTV News' fashion correspondent on the red carpet during the preshow, which airs at 8 p.m. ET.
The VMAs will be hosted for the second year in a row by British comedian Russell Brand. The evening's performers include Beyoncé, Jay-Z, Lady Gaga, Green Day, Pink, Taylor Swift and Muse. Katy Perry, Ne-Yo, Nelly Furtado, Chace Crawford, Leighton Meester and Miranda Cosgrove are set to present awards.

While Taylor Swift was making her acceptance speech for winning Best Female Video, Kanye West got on stage, interrupted her, and took her microphone, saying that Beyoncé should have won with "Single Ladies (Put a Ring on It)". Beyonce looked shocked and West was then booed by the crowd. After Beyoncé won Video of the Year, she allowed Swift to come on stage and complete her speech.
